What occurs if an SR-22 insurance policy is canceled?

The cancellation of an SR-22 insurance policy can often lead to major effects. When an insurance holder's SR-22 insurance is terminated - whether because of non-payment, plan gap, or any other factor - insurance service providers have an obligation to alert the proper state authorities regarding this adjustment. This is accomplished by filing an SR-26 form, which properly indicates completion of the policyholder's SR-22 insurance protection.

As soon as the proper state authorities have been alerted of the cancellation of SR-22 insurance, the impacted car driver's license can possibly be put on hold again. This is due to the authorities' need to ensure that the motorists are continually insured while they are having the SR-22 requirement. Thus, the driver could have to look for non-owner SR-22 insurance if the car was not in their possession at the time of the termination. This reinstatement of the car driver's SR-22 requirement can result in even more headaches down the line, along with possible increases in insurance premiums. Proactivity in maintaining an SR-22 insurance policy is extremely suggested to prevent such scenarios.

What's the distinction between SR-22 and FR-44?

Both SR-22 and FR-44 are types of financial responsibility that give evidence of auto insurance. The primary distinction is that FR-44 is required in Florida and Virginia for motorists convicted of a drunk driving and frequently requires greater liability limits than the SR-22.
